      <i_freetext>Intervention 1: For each group in this research, four different hemodialysis protocols are implemented. These protocols are as follows: Protocol 1: Linear Sodium Dialysate (150 - 138mEq/L) and constant Ultraﬁltration. Protocol 2: Constant Sodium Dialysate (140 mEq/L) and gradient ultraﬁltration. Protocol 3: Linear Sodium Dialysate (150 - 138 mEq/L) and gradient ultraﬁltration. Protocol 4: (standard hemodialysis) = Constant Sodium Dialysate (140 mEq/L) and constant Ultraﬁltration. Linear Sodium Dialysate: In the first hour of the dialysis the amount of Sodium dialysate is 150mEq/L, then is gradually decreasing by 4mEq/L per hour. In the last hour of the dialysis, it reaches 138mEq/L. Gradient Ultraﬁltration: Two-thirds of the fluid acquired between 2 dialysis sessions is removed during the first two hours of the dialysis and the reset in the last two hours. This protocol can be programmed on Gambro AK96 dialysis machine. Constant Ultraﬁltration: The excessive fluid acquired between hemodialysis is determined. This fluid is taken back in equal volumes in each hour of a four -hour dialysis session. Constant Sodium Dialysate: During a four -hour -dialysis session, sodium dialysate is kept in140 mEq/L. For any patients, six hemodialysis sessions are considered for each of the protocols. For group A, protocols, 1-2-3 and 4 run respectively. Intervention 2: For Group B, protocols, 2-3-4 and 1 run respectively. Intervention 3: For Group C, protocols, 3-4-1 and 2 run respectively. Intervention 4: For Group D, protocols, 4-1-2 and 3 run respectively.</i_freetext>

      <inclusion_criteria>Inclusion criteria: hemodialysis patients in Panje Azar Hospital of Gorgan, who have: 1- hypotension for more than three sessions during last month (20 percent of the sessions). 2- Age of 18-75 years. 3- hemodialysis for more than three months. 4- Dialysis for three times a week with a solution of sodium bicarbonate. 5- End-stage renal diseases. Exclusion criteria: The patients, 1- Before starting dialysis, having systolic blood pressure of below 100 mm Hg. 2- Patients with complications studied in this project (cramps, nausea, vomiting and headache). 3- Administered analgesic, anti-hypertensive and anti-spasmodic, four hours before of dialysis.</inclusion_criteria>
